FledglingMan
码龄12年
关注
提问 私信
  • 博客:7,398
    7,398
    总访问量
  • 7
    原创
  • 491,761
    排名
  • 0
    粉丝
  • 0
    铁粉

个人简介:爱学习,成长中

IP属地以运营商信息为准,境内显示到省(区、市),境外显示到国家(地区)
IP 属地:浙江省
  • 加入CSDN时间: 2013-04-25
博客简介:

FledglingMan的博客

博客描述:
爱学习,不够实力派
查看详细资料
个人成就
  • 获得10次点赞
  • 内容获得2次评论
  • 获得14次收藏
  • 博客总排名491,761名
创作历程
  • 9篇
    2017年
成就勋章
TA的专栏
  • 算法
    5篇
  • 动态规划
    4篇
  • 贪心算法
    1篇
  • 面试经验
    2篇
  • spring
    1篇
  • C/C++基础概念
    1篇
创作活动更多

『技术文档』写作方法征文挑战赛

在技术的浩瀚海洋中,一份优秀的技术文档宛如精准的航海图。它是知识传承的载体,是团队协作的桥梁,更是产品成功的幕后英雄。然而,打造这样一份出色的技术文档并非易事。你是否在为如何清晰阐释复杂技术而苦恼?是否纠结于文档结构与内容的完美融合?无论你是技术大神还是初涉此领域的新手,都欢迎分享你的宝贵经验、独到见解与创新方法,为技术传播之路点亮明灯!

55人参与 去参加
  • 最近
  • 文章
  • 代码仓
  • 资源
  • 问答
  • 帖子
  • 视频
  • 课程
  • 关注/订阅/互动
  • 收藏
搜TA的内容
搜索 取消

04动态规划进阶---背包问题

背包问题可能是动态规划算法中最经典的问题了,三种最常见的背包问题分别是0-1背包问题,完全背包问题和多重背包问题。关于这三种背包的讲解网上有很多,但是很多只是给出状态转移方程或写出伪代码,或者是只给出0-1背包和完全背包的代码但并没有多重背包的代码,因此本文在这里将系统地总结这三种背包问题的最佳解法及相应java代码。题1.经典的0-1背包问题。给定一组物品,每种物品都有自己的重量和价格,在限
原创
发布博客 2017.10.11 ·
629 阅读 ·
1 点赞 ·
0 评论 ·
0 收藏

03动态规划基础---机器人走方格问题

题目1.对于m*n的方格(注意m,n为x,y轴顶点数),机器人只能向右走或向下走,求机器人从方格左上角走到右下角共有多少种走法。对于2*2的方格有两种走法,3*3的方格有6种走法,求对m*n的方格有多少种走法。首先分析题目的状态转移方程,因为机器人只能向右或向下走,对于非边界的每一个顶点array[i][j],都有dp[i][j]=dp[i-1][j]+dp[i][j-1],其中dp[i][j
原创
发布博客 2017.10.10 ·
1395 阅读 ·
1 点赞 ·
0 评论 ·
3 收藏

02动态规划基础---最大连续子序列的和

关于动态规划的相关理解我在上一篇博客动态规划基础01---最长递增子序列中写过,这一篇我们主要练习类似的dp算法题。题1.对于包含任意正负数的整型数组,求它的最大连续子序列和。比如说,数组array={1,2,3,-7,4,5,6},则它的最大连续子序列为4,5,6,和为15.首先还是先分析题目的状态转移方程,设maxCur[i]为前i个数字的最大连续子序列和,则当 maxCur[i-
原创
发布博客 2017.10.10 ·
398 阅读 ·
1 点赞 ·
0 评论 ·
0 收藏

01动态规划基础---最长递增子序列长度

最近在做动态规划的专题训练,准备写一个动态规划的专栏,因为题目较多,打算分几篇来写。对于动态规划的概念网上有很多,个人理解对于动态问题,最重要的是写出状态转移方程,其次是写出边界条件,最后根据状态转移方程和边界条件进行代码编写。需要注意的是,与递归方法相比,动态规划是自底向上的,而递归是自顶向下的。所以对于递归问题,我们首先要写出顶层的递推公式,再写出底层的递推出口;而对于动态规划问题,我们往
原创
发布博客 2017.10.10 ·
298 阅读 ·
1 点赞 ·
1 评论 ·
2 收藏

Java面试常考题--自定义简单HashMap类

自定义实现简单HashMap类,美团一面答得不好的一道题,回来之后自己又实现了一遍。简易版HashMap,能实现最基本的put()和get()操作。package JavaLearning;import java.util.ArrayList;public class MyHashMap { Object key; Object value; Object [] arrays=
原创
发布博客 2017.09.20 ·
311 阅读 ·
1 点赞 ·
0 评论 ·
1 收藏

JAVA贪心算法实现背包问题

以下贪心算法相关概念及题目转载自http://blog.csdn.net/effective_coder/article/details/8736718,java实现代码为博主原创贪心算法思想:顾名思义,贪心算法总是作出在当前看来最好的选择。也就是说贪心算法并不从整体最优考虑,它所作出的选择只是在某种意义上的局部最优选择。当然,希望贪心算法得到的最终结果也是整体最优的。虽然贪心
转载
发布博客 2017.09.12 ·
2608 阅读 ·
1 点赞 ·
0 评论 ·
10 收藏

Spring 控制反转(IOC)与依赖注入(DI)

最近在学习Spring的一些基础知识与重要概念,以下内容转载自http://jinnianshilongnian.iteye.com/blog/1413846,该博客通俗易懂,对理解Spring IOC和DI很有帮助,与网友共同学习。2.1.1  IoC是什么Ioc—Inversion of Control,即“控制反转”,不是什么技术,而是一种设计思想。在Java开发中,Ioc意
转载
发布博客 2017.09.12 ·
210 阅读 ·
1 点赞 ·
0 评论 ·
1 收藏

第一次面试经验总结

第一次接到电话要我到某互联网公司面试,公司是做地理信息系统的。由于该公司是在智联上找到我的,而且现在是九月初,我估计他们是社招。不过凭着锻炼自己,打怪升级的心态我还是去了,毕竟大公司很难进入面试,光学校排名和在线笔试就能刷不少人。不过有一点坑的是,我开始以为面试地点不远,结果早上坐出租时才知道巨远,光从学校坐过去就花了近六十大洋,所以回学校的时候乖乖坐公交,转了两趟车,坐到想吐~~所以提醒大家,去
原创
发布博客 2017.09.11 ·
852 阅读 ·
1 点赞 ·
0 评论 ·
0 收藏

C++中*与&的使用和辨析

在C/C++中,关于*与&,在不同情况下,有不同含义:(1)*的使用 a)定义时,*声明创建的为指针变量,如 int a=0;int* p=&a; b)在使用指针变量时,*表示取值操作,对于指针p,会取出p指向变量的值,如 cout(2)&的使用 a)在与指针联合使用,如 int a=0;int *p=&a时,表示取a的地址,然后赋给指针p; b)作引用类型使用,如 int a=0;int b
原创
发布博客 2017.09.03 ·
697 阅读 ·
2 点赞 ·
1 评论 ·
3 收藏

MFC教程.rar

发布资源 2013.04.25 ·
rar